Kingsey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

This surname is derived from a geographical locality. 'of Kingsey,' a parish in Buckinghamshire, two miles from Thame. The suffix is -hay, as in Fotheringhay; v. Hay.

John de Kyngeshaye, Suffolk, 1273. Hundred Rolls.

William de Kyngeshaye, Suffolk, ibid.

1710. Married — Peter Kingsey and Ann Amler: St. Antholin (London).

1764. Married — Evan Kingsey and Mary Platts: St. George, Hanover Square.

A Dictionary of English and Welsh Surnames (1896) by Charles Wareing Endell Bardsley

(English) 1 belonging to Kingsey (Oxon) = the King’s Waterside [Old English í(e)g] Kingsey is on the River Thame.

2 Dweller at the King’s Hey or Hay [Old English ge)hǽg, meadow] John de Kyngeshaye.—Hundred Rolls

Surnames of the United Kingdom (1912) by Henry Harrison

How Common Is The Last Name Kingsey? popularity and diffusion

It is the 5,057,639th most frequently occurring last name worldwide, borne by around 1 in 485,836,394 people. Kingsey is predominantly found in Africa, where 73 percent of Kingsey are found; 67 percent are found in West Africa and 67 percent are found in Atlantic-Niger Africa. Kingsey is also the 743,570th most frequently occurring first name throughout the world It is held by 153 people.

The surname is most frequently occurring in Nigeria, where it is held by 10 people, or 1 in 17,714,276. In Nigeria Kingsey is most prevalent in: Lagos, where 30 percent reside, Abia, where 10 percent reside and Akwa Ibom, where 10 percent reside. Beside Nigeria this surname exists in 4 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 13 percent reside and Australia, where 7 percent reside.

Kingsey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The incidence of Kingsey has changed over time. In The United States the number of people bearing the Kingsey surname decreased 87 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it decreased 67 percent between 1881 and 2014.
